Introduction

District Child Protection Units (DCPU) play a vital role in ensuring the safety and well-being of children in India. These units are responsible for implementing various child protection schemes and programs at the district level, and for coordinating with other departments to ensure that children receive the support and services they need. In this article, we will explore the role and functions of District Child Protection Units in India, and examine the key challenges and opportunities facing these units.

Role and Functions of District Child Protection Units

The main objective of District Child Protection Units is to ensure that children in the district are protected from exploitation and abuse, and that they have access to education, healthcare, and other essential services. To achieve this objective, DCPU perform a range of functions, including:

  • Monitoring and supervising child protection services, including foster care and adoption services
  • Investigating child abuse cases, and providing support and counseling to victims
  • Coordinating with other departments, such as the police and healthcare services, to ensure that children receive the support and services they need
  • Raising awareness about child protection issues among the community, and providing training and capacity-building programs for stakeholders

Key Challenges Facing District Child Protection Units

Despite the importance of their work, District Child Protection Units in India face a range of challenges, including:

  • Limited resources and funding, which can make it difficult to provide adequate support and services to children
  • Lack of awareness and understanding about child protection issues among the community, which can make it difficult to identify and respond to cases of child abuse and exploitation
  • Corruption and inefficiency within the system, which can undermine the effectiveness of child protection services

Opportunities for Improvement

Despite these challenges, there are also opportunities for improvement and innovation in the field of child protection in India. For example:

  • The use of technology, such as mobile apps and online platforms, to raise awareness and provide support to children and families
  • The development of community-based child protection programs, which can provide support and services to children in their own communities
  • The provision of training and capacity-building programs for stakeholders, including government officials, healthcare workers, and community leaders
